CVE-2026-57227
Description
Suricata is a network Intrusion Detection System, Intrusion Prevention System and Network Security Monitoring engine. From 7.0.0 until 7.0.17 and 8.0.6, the MQTT parser in rust/src/mqtt/mqtt.rs permits repeated PUBREC or PUBREL messages to be appended to one transaction without a limit. Crafted MQTT traffic can grow transaction state indefinitely, consuming CPU and memory and causing slowdown or denial of service. This issue is fixed in versions 8.0.6 and 7.0.17.
